/*
* File: ipc/ipc_init.c
* Author: Rich Draves
* Date: 1989
*
* Functions to initialize the IPC system.
*/
#import <mach/features.h>
#include <mach/kern_return.h>
#include <kern/mach_param.h>
#include <kern/ipc_host.h>
#include <vm/vm_map.h>
#include <vm/vm_kern.h>
#include <ipc/ipc_entry.h>
#include <ipc/ipc_space.h>
#include <ipc/ipc_object.h>
#include <ipc/ipc_port.h>
#include <ipc/ipc_pset.h>
#include <ipc/ipc_marequest.h>
#include <ipc/ipc_notify.h>
#include <ipc/ipc_kmsg.h>
#include <ipc/ipc_hash.h>
#include <ipc/ipc_init.h>
#include <mach/machine/ndr.h>
#if MACH_OLD_VM_COPY
task_t ipc_soft_task;
vm_map_t ipc_soft_map;
#endif
vm_map_t ipc_kernel_map;
vm_size_t ipc_kernel_map_size = 1024 * 1024;
vm_map_t ipc_kernel_copy_map;
#define IPC_KERNEL_COPY_MAP_SIZE (8 * 1024 * 1024)
vm_size_t ipc_kernel_copy_map_size = IPC_KERNEL_COPY_MAP_SIZE;
int ipc_space_max = SPACE_MAX;
int ipc_tree_entry_max = ITE_MAX;
int ipc_port_max = PORT_MAX;
int ipc_pset_max = SET_MAX;
extern void mig_init(void);
/*
* Routine: ipc_bootstrap
* Purpose:
* Initialization needed before the kernel task
* can be created.
*/
void
ipc_bootstrap(void)
{
kern_return_t kr;
ipc_port_multiple_lock_init();
ipc_port_timestamp_lock_init();
ipc_port_timestamp_data = 0;
/* all IPC zones should be exhaustible */
ipc_space_zone = zinit(sizeof(struct ipc_space),
ipc_space_max * sizeof(struct ipc_space),
sizeof(struct ipc_space),
FALSE, "ipc spaces");
/* make it exhaustible */
zchange(ipc_space_zone, FALSE, FALSE, TRUE, FALSE);
ipc_tree_entry_zone =
zinit(sizeof(struct ipc_tree_entry),
ipc_tree_entry_max * sizeof(struct ipc_tree_entry),
sizeof(struct ipc_tree_entry),
FALSE, "ipc tree entries");
/* make it exhaustible */
zchange(ipc_tree_entry_zone, FALSE, FALSE, TRUE, FALSE);
ipc_object_zones[IOT_PORT] =
zinit(sizeof(struct ipc_port),
ipc_port_max * sizeof(struct ipc_port),
sizeof(struct ipc_port),
FALSE, "ipc ports");
/* make it exhaustible */
zchange(ipc_object_zones[IOT_PORT], FALSE, FALSE, TRUE, FALSE);
ipc_object_zones[IOT_PORT_SET] =
zinit(sizeof(struct ipc_pset),
ipc_pset_max * sizeof(struct ipc_pset),
sizeof(struct ipc_pset),
FALSE, "ipc port sets");
/* make it exhaustible */
zchange(ipc_object_zones[IOT_PORT_SET], FALSE, FALSE, TRUE, FALSE);
/* create special spaces */
kr = ipc_space_create_special(&ipc_space_kernel);
assert(kr == KERN_SUCCESS);
kr = ipc_space_create_special(&ipc_space_reply);
assert(kr == KERN_SUCCESS);
/* initialize modules with hidden data structures */
ipc_table_init();
ipc_notify_init();
ipc_hash_init();
ipc_marequest_init();
}
/*
* Routine: ipc_init
* Purpose:
* Final initialization of the IPC system.
*/
void
ipc_init(void)
{
vm_offset_t min, max;
#if MACH_OLD_VM_COPY
if (task_create(TASK_NULL, FALSE, &ipc_soft_task) != KERN_SUCCESS)
panic("ipc_init");
ipc_soft_map = ipc_soft_task->map;
{
vm_offset_t x = 0;
/*
* XXX
* Allocate page zero here
* so that it can't be used as
* the address of a valid copy
* region.
* XXX
*/
(void) vm_allocate(ipc_soft_map, &x, PAGE_SIZE, FALSE);
}
#endif /* MACH_OLD_VM_COPY */
ipc_kernel_map = kmem_suballoc(kernel_map, &min, &max,
ipc_kernel_map_size, TRUE);
ipc_kernel_copy_map = kmem_suballoc(kernel_map, &min, &max,
ipc_kernel_copy_map_size, TRUE);
ipc_host_init();
}
